ACPI: video: Add "vendor" quirks for 3 Lenovo x86 Android tablets
Like the Xiaomi Mi Pad 2 these 3 Lenovo x86 Android tablet models also use a TI LP8557 backlight controller in direct I2C brightness register control mode. Add "vendor" quirks for these 3 models to disable the non-working native / acpi_video backlight devices. Signed-off-by: Hans de Goede <hdegoede@redhat.com> Signed-off-by: Rafael J.
